版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領
文檔簡介
2026年MOOC操作系統(tǒng)原理考點練習題及答案一、單選題(共10題,每題2分)1.在操作系統(tǒng)中,進程與程序的主要區(qū)別在于()。A.進程是動態(tài)的,程序是靜態(tài)的B.進程占用更多內(nèi)存C.進程可以并發(fā)執(zhí)行,程序不能D.進程有狀態(tài),程序沒有2.下面哪種調(diào)度算法可能會出現(xiàn)饑餓現(xiàn)象?()A.先來先服務(FCFS)B.短作業(yè)優(yōu)先(SJF)C.輪轉(zhuǎn)調(diào)度(RoundRobin)D.多級反饋隊列調(diào)度3.分段存儲管理中,地址翻譯過程涉及的主要數(shù)據(jù)結(jié)構(gòu)是()。A.頁表B.段表C.頁面置換算法表D.內(nèi)存分配表4.在虛擬內(nèi)存管理中,頁面置換算法的目的是()。A.提高內(nèi)存利用率B.減少缺頁中斷次數(shù)C.增加系統(tǒng)吞吐量D.以上都是5.以下哪種同步機制可以防止競態(tài)條件?()A.信號量B.記錄鎖C.互斥鎖D.以上都是6.死鎖產(chǎn)生的必要條件不包括()。A.互斥B.請求和保持C.循環(huán)等待D.非搶占式調(diào)度7.設備驅(qū)動程序的主要功能是()。A.管理設備資源B.處理設備中斷C.提供設備抽象接口D.以上都是8.在文件系統(tǒng)中,目錄結(jié)構(gòu)通常采用()。A.線性結(jié)構(gòu)B.樹形結(jié)構(gòu)C.圖結(jié)構(gòu)D.鏈式結(jié)構(gòu)9.磁盤調(diào)度算法中,最短尋道時間優(yōu)先(SSTF)算法的缺點是()。A.可能導致饑餓B.平均尋道時間較長C.實現(xiàn)簡單D.無法處理隨機請求10.I/O控制方式中,不適用于高速設備的是()。A.中斷驅(qū)動B.DMAC.軟件中斷D.通道二、多選題(共5題,每題3分)1.操作系統(tǒng)的功能包括()。A.進程管理B.內(nèi)存管理C.文件管理D.設備管理E.用戶接口2.頁面置換算法可能引發(fā)的問題是()。A.缺頁中斷B.頻繁換入換出(Belady現(xiàn)象)C.饑餓D.內(nèi)存碎片E.地址翻譯延遲3.死鎖避免算法包括()。A.銀行家算法B.資源分配圖C.拒絕分配策略D.競態(tài)檢測E.預防死鎖4.設備管理的功能包括()。A.設備分配B.設備控制C.設備獨立性D.中斷處理E.設備調(diào)度5.文件系統(tǒng)的共享機制包括()。A.讀-寫共享B.寫-寫互斥C.設備共享D.文件鎖E.原子操作三、判斷題(共10題,每題1分)1.進程的上下文切換是指將進程的狀態(tài)信息從內(nèi)存加載到CPU寄存器。(√)2.短作業(yè)優(yōu)先調(diào)度算法一定能最小化平均等待時間。(×)3.虛擬內(nèi)存允許程序使用比物理內(nèi)存更大的地址空間。(√)4.信號量S的初值可以大于1,表示多個進程可以同時進入臨界區(qū)。(×)5.死鎖只能通過資源剝奪來解決。(×)6.DMA方式可以提高I/O傳輸?shù)男?,但會增加CPU負擔。(×)7.文件系統(tǒng)的索引節(jié)點(Inode)存儲文件的元數(shù)據(jù)。(√)8.磁盤調(diào)度算法的目的是最小化尋道時間。(×)9.設備獨立性軟件層次包括設備驅(qū)動程序、設備獨立性接口和用戶程序。(√)10.文件共享可以提高資源利用率,但可能導致數(shù)據(jù)不一致問題。(√)四、簡答題(共5題,每題5分)1.簡述進程與線程的區(qū)別。2.解釋什么是缺頁中斷及其處理過程。3.什么是臨界區(qū)?如何解決臨界區(qū)問題?4.磁盤調(diào)度算法有哪些?簡述FCFS算法的特點。5.文件系統(tǒng)如何實現(xiàn)文件共享?五、綜合應用題(共3題,每題10分)1.某系統(tǒng)中有3個進程P1、P2、P3,它們請求的資源數(shù)如下表所示。系統(tǒng)可用資源數(shù)為(5,3,2)。問該系統(tǒng)是否處于安全狀態(tài)?若不安全,給出安全序列。|進程|最大需求|已分配|還需資源|||-|--|-||P1|(3,2,2)|(1,1,0)|(2,1,2)||P2|(6,1,5)|(2,0,2)|(4,1,3)||P3|(7,3,3)|(3,1,1)|(4,2,2)|2.設內(nèi)存大小為100MB,頁面大小為4KB,某進程的地址空間為512MB。若采用固定分配方式,每個進程分配多少個頁面?若采用分頁虛擬內(nèi)存,缺頁中斷率為10%,每次缺頁處理時間為100ms,求進程運行的平均等待時間。3.某文件系統(tǒng)采用索引節(jié)點(Inode)結(jié)構(gòu),每個Inode包含10個直接塊指針、1個一次間接塊指針、1個二次間接塊指針和1個三次間接塊指針。每個塊大小為4KB。若某文件的大小為256MB,計算該文件占用的磁盤空間。答案及解析一、單選題答案1.A解析:進程是動態(tài)的執(zhí)行單元,程序是靜態(tài)的代碼,進程會隨狀態(tài)變化而變化,程序不會。2.B解析:短作業(yè)優(yōu)先(SJF)可能使長作業(yè)一直等待,導致饑餓。3.B解析:分段存儲管理中,段表用于地址翻譯。4.D解析:頁面置換算法的目標是優(yōu)化內(nèi)存利用、減少缺頁中斷、提高吞吐量。5.D解析:信號量、記錄鎖、互斥鎖都是同步機制,可以防止競態(tài)條件。6.D解析:死鎖的必要條件包括互斥、請求和保持、循環(huán)等待、非搶占式資源分配。7.D解析:設備驅(qū)動程序管理設備資源、處理中斷、提供抽象接口。8.B解析:文件系統(tǒng)通常采用樹形目錄結(jié)構(gòu)。9.A解析:SSTF可能使某些進程長期得不到服務,導致饑餓。10.C解析:軟件中斷依賴CPU指令,不適用于高速設備。二、多選題答案1.A,B,C,D,E解析:操作系統(tǒng)功能包括進程、內(nèi)存、文件、設備管理和用戶接口。2.A,B,C,D,E解析:頁面置換可能引發(fā)缺頁中斷、Belady現(xiàn)象、饑餓、內(nèi)存碎片和地址翻譯延遲。3.A,B,C,E解析:銀行家算法、資源分配圖、拒絕分配策略、預防死鎖都是死鎖避免方法。4.A,B,C,D,E解析:設備管理功能包括分配、控制、獨立性、中斷處理和調(diào)度。5.A,B,D,E解析:文件共享機制包括讀-寫共享、寫-寫互斥、文件鎖和原子操作。三、判斷題答案1.√解析:上下文切換涉及狀態(tài)信息加載。2.×解析:SJF可能使長作業(yè)饑餓。3.√解析:虛擬內(nèi)存允許更大地址空間。4.×解析:信號量初值大于1時,多個進程可進入。5.×解析:死鎖可通過搶占式調(diào)度解決。6.×解析:DMA減輕CPU負擔。7.√解析:Inode存儲元數(shù)據(jù)。8.×解析:目標是最小化平均尋道時間。9.√解析:層次包括驅(qū)動程序、獨立性接口和用戶程序。10.√解析:共享可能導致數(shù)據(jù)不一致。四、簡答題答案1.進程與線程的區(qū)別-進程是資源分配的基本單位,線程是CPU調(diào)度的基本單位。-進程有獨立的地址空間,線程共享進程地址空間。-進程切換開銷大,線程切換開銷小。2.缺頁中斷及其處理過程-缺頁中斷:進程訪問的頁不在內(nèi)存時觸發(fā)。-處理過程:保存現(xiàn)場、查找空閑頁、若無空閑則置換頁、恢復現(xiàn)場、繼續(xù)執(zhí)行。3.臨界區(qū)及解決方法-臨界區(qū):進程中訪問共享資源的一段代碼。-解決方法:互斥鎖、信號量、原子操作。4.磁盤調(diào)度算法及FCFS特點-算法:FCFS、SSTF、SCAN、C-SCAN等。-FCFS特點:按請求順序執(zhí)行,簡單但平均尋道時間長。5.文件共享實現(xiàn)-通過文件鎖、共享權限設置實現(xiàn)。五、綜合應用題答案1.安全狀態(tài)判斷-計算可用資源:(5-1,3-1,2-0)=(4,2,2)。-安全序列:P1→P3→P2(P1需要(2,1,2),可用(4,2,2)滿足,分配后剩余(2,1,2);P3需要(4,2,2),可用(2,1,2)滿足,分配后剩余(0,0,0);P2需要(4,1,3),可用(0,0,0)不滿足,系統(tǒng)不安全。-結(jié)論:系統(tǒng)不安全。2.分頁虛擬內(nèi)存計算-進程頁面數(shù):512MB/4KB=128K頁。-平均等待時間:10%×100ms=10ms。3.文件空間占用計算-直接塊:10×4KB=40KB。-一次間接塊:1×256×4KB
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年中職(連鎖門店運營)門店日常管理階段測試試題及答案
- 2025年中職(樂器制造與維護)二胡制作工藝階段測試題及答案
- 2025年中職(汽車運用與維修)汽車底盤構(gòu)造試題及答案
- 2025年大學藥品與醫(yī)療器械(醫(yī)療器械檢測)試題及答案
- 2025年高職衛(wèi)星通信技術(衛(wèi)星通信應用)試題及答案
- 2025年大學紡織服裝類(紡織性能測試)試題及答案
- 中國課件介紹
- 養(yǎng)老院老人請假審批制度
- 養(yǎng)老院老人生活娛樂活動組織人員行為規(guī)范制度
- 養(yǎng)老院老人康復理療師激勵制度
- 萬物皆模型:100個思維模型
- 培訓學校工資結(jié)構(gòu)
- 福建省泉州實驗中學2026屆九上物理期中學業(yè)水平測試試題含解析
- 2025貴州遵義市大數(shù)據(jù)集團有限公司招聘工作人員筆試及人員筆試歷年參考題庫附帶答案詳解
- 2026山東省考申論試題及答案
- 新三體系培訓教材
- 現(xiàn)代無人機航拍技術應用講義
- 北師大簡介課件
- 針刺傷預防處理標準解讀
- 機器人工程技術人員筆試試題及答案
- crm系統(tǒng)使用管理辦法
評論
0/150
提交評論